Quarterly Planning Note — Legacy Pricing Update

Heads up, branch managers: starting next quarter, Fennick Software is raising prices for customers still on the legacy Cobalt plans. The bump averages eight percent, with grandfathered caps for anyone who renewed in the last six months. Expect some pushback — we've prepped talking points and a migration discount to the Aster tier. Please brief your account teams before notices go out and log objections in the usual tracker. The reasoning behind the timing is below.

board note of bajop-yaweg: The western region missed its Pelys quota by 58.0 percent last quarter. Pelysek Foods plans to raise the Belius list price by 44.0 percent in July. The steering committee signed off on a budget of $133.8 million for Project Pelax. The renewal with Zoraelix Systems closes at $61.9 million a year, 12.7 percent above the last contract.

Subject: DR Drill Tuesday — Queue Migration Check

Hi Marisol, during Tuesday's disaster-recovery drill we'll validate the cutover from the homegrown Sparrowtail job queue to Drayline. Please confirm the dead-letter replay works from the cold standby, and log any dropped jobs in the Pellew tracker. When the standby's restore console asks for it, use the recovery passphrase provided immediately below.

vault phrase of tajeg-tageg = pelix-druix-holius-briael-zorwyn-frawyn-fraox-norok-drueth-aldiel

## AgriLink Gateway — Environments

Three environments: dev, staging, prod. Dev accepts self-signed device certs; staging and prod require certs from the Fenwick internal CA. Telemetry ingress is mTLS only; no plaintext listeners anywhere. Prod runs in two regions with active-active ingestion. Staging mirrors prod topology at reduced scale. For review purposes, the production environment runs with the configuration values below.

service settings:
[casax]
port = 6379
team = rusir
host = casax.zemvarhq.corp
region = outer-4
access_code = ac_9808ce
timeout_ms = 1500